It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Kenneth H Snyder (Minneapolis, Minnesota), born in Melrose, Minnesota, who passed away on March 2, 2019, at the age of 77, leaving to mourn family and friends. He was loved and cherished by many people including: his parents, Raymond Snyder and Louise Snyder; his wife Betsey; his children, David (Linda), Stephen (Abby Ekstrand), Wayne (Jacque) and Lori (Joe O'Brien); his grandchildren, Joseph (Ashley), Cory, Rachel, Hailey, Mitchell and Bradley; and his great grandchildren, Jayce and Lily. He was also cherished by many nephews, nieces, cousins, family and friends.
